韓國에 自生 또는 栽培되는 paeonia屬의 細胞學的 硏究 Ⅱ. 栽培芍藥과 山芍藥과의 交雜種의 核型
Cytological studies on wild or cultivated paeonia species in Korea Ⅱ. Karyotypes of hybrid between wild and cultivated P. albiflora

Peculiar F₁, individual derived from the crossing of cultivated species of P. albiflora and wild species of P. albiflora and triploid from F₁, seed were investigated on the size of chromosome, arm ratios and presence of satellite chromosome. On the size, the chromosmes of cultivated species of P. albiflora are ranged from 7.8 to 14.9, F₁ No.1 which is green and havily serrated in the edge of a white patal are 7.0 to 10.7μ, F₁ No.2 which is red and heavily serrated in the edge of a white petal are 7.6 to 10.7Fμ, and triploid from F₁ seed are 7.2 to 10.2μ, 7.1 to 10.6μ and 7.2 to 11.2μ. The subterminal, less than 33% of arm ratio exsist in F₁ chromosome of cultivated species, wild species, F₁ and triploid, and A-D chromosomes are either submedian. The cultivated species has SAT-chromosome in a single of E chromosome, and F₁ No.1 in a pair of E chromosome, while both F₁ No.2 and triploid have no SAT-chromosome. It is supposed that pollinated with a gamete(n=10), either male or famale of parents of F₁ that is pink and ptted in petals become a triploid.
